Zero calibration device
By using a combination of sleeve, tail plug, magnetic scale, limit ring and other structures in the zero point calibration device, and using needle bearings to isolate the rotational motion, the problem of magnetic scale cable entanglement is solved, and high-precision and reliable zero point calibration is achieved.

TECHNICAL FIELD
[0001] The present application relates to the technical field of robots, and in particular to a zero point calibration device. BACKGROUND
[0002] In the field of high-precision motion control of industrial robots, the accuracy of zero point calibration directly determines the positioning accuracy of the tool center point (TCP) and the subsequent trajectory motion accuracy.
[0003] The current mainstream technology generally adopts a rotating position feedback scheme in which a magnetic grating ruler is rigidly connected with a tail plug of a joint of a robot. However, since the magnetic grating ruler needs to rotate synchronously with the tail plug, the signal transmission cable connected to the tail of the magnetic grating ruler will continuously accumulate the number of twists in the repeated calibration process, resulting in irreversible spiral winding of the cable. In the long-term operation, the insulation layer of the cable is broken due to mechanical fatigue caused by repeated twisting, and at the same time, the internal conductor contact resistance is easily increased or changed, and even the signal transmission is interrupted. This inherent structural problem seriously restricts the reliability of the calibration process and the service life of the equipment, and becomes a key bottleneck for improving the absolute positioning accuracy of the robot. [0012] The zero point calibration device provided in the present application needs to be fixed on the robot shaft to be calibrated during installation. The sleeve is stably installed on the zero point stud through the threaded connection mechanism, and the top of the sleeve extends into the positioning hole to ensure the accuracy of the installation position. During the working process of the device, when the shaft to be calibrated starts to rotate, the sleeve, the tail plug and the second probe rotate synchronously. At the same time, the profile of the measuring groove on the robot changes with the rotation of the shaft to be calibrated. This profile change drives the second probe of the robot to produce axial displacement. The axial displacement is pre-tightened by the elastic element, and then transmitted to the first probe, and then the displacement is transmitted to the measuring head of the magnetic grating ruler by the first probe, and finally the measuring head of the magnetic grating ruler moves. The magnetic grating ruler can generate signals corresponding to the displacement in real time, and transmit these signals to the control system. After receiving the signals, the control system draws an "M" type displacement curve, and then automatically identifies the lowest point in the curve, and records the corresponding joint angle value at this time, which is the zero point position of the shaft to be calibrated. In this process, the needle roller bearing can keep the magnetic grating ruler stationary independent of the rotating tail plug, effectively avoiding the cable winding problem caused by the rotation of the tail plug. When the first probe bottom continuously contacts the measuring head of the magnetic grating ruler, the displacement information can be stably transmitted before reaching the zero point position. When the zero point position is reached, the measuring groove will sink, which will trigger a sudden change in displacement, and then the accurate zero point calibration is completed. The zero point calibration device of the present application isolates the rotational motion of the magnetic grating ruler and the tail plug through the needle roller bearing, fundamentally solving the problem of broken tail cable of the magnetic grating ruler due to twisting, and improving the service life of the device; the preset stroke of the measuring head in the limiting cylinder is not less than the distance from the bottom of the limiting cylinder to the top of the limiting ring, and the limiting cylinder can timely block the pressure transmission when the displacement of the measuring head exceeds the preset stroke, effectively avoiding damage to the measuring head of the magnetic grating ruler due to excessive pressure, thereby ensuring the reliability of high-precision measurement. [0023] The embodiment of the present application provides a zero point calibration device, such as Figures 1 to 6 As shown. The zero point calibration device includes a sleeve 1, a tail plug 2, a magnetic scale 3, a limiting ring 4, a first probe 5, an elastic element 6 and a limiting cylinder 7. A threaded connection mechanism is provided at the bottom of the sleeve 1, which is used to be detachably connected to the zero point stud of the axis to be calibrated of the robot. The top of the sleeve 1 extends into the positioning hole of the axis to be calibrated, and the top of the positioning hole is provided with the second probe of the robot. The inner wall of the sleeve 1 is provided with a step 11. One end of the tail plug 2 extends into the sleeve 1 and is fixedly connected to the sleeve 1, and the tail plug 2 has an axial cavity 21. The magnetic scale 3 is arranged in the axial cavity 21, and the measuring head 31 of the magnetic scale 3 extends from the top of the tail plug 2. Specifically, the magnetic scale 3 of the present application is a high-precision displacement measuring component that can sense tiny displacements of its measuring head 31.
[0024] The magnetic scale 3 is electrically connected to the control system. Specifically, the tail cable of the magnetic scale 3 is connected to the control system. A needle roller bearing 8 is positioned between the outer wall of the magnetic scale 3 and the inner wall of the axial cavity 21 of the tail plug 2. This needle roller bearing 8 isolates the magnetic scale 3 from the tail plug 2, allowing relative rotation between the two.
[0025] The first probe 5 is disposed within the sleeve 1, with its top contacting the robot's second probe. The side of the probe 5 facing away from the top abuts against a step 11, preventing the first probe 5 from falling off. A stopper 7 is fixed to the bottom of the first probe 5, and the measuring head 31 of the magnetic scale 3 extends into the stopper 7. The preset travel of the measuring head 31 within the stopper 7 is no less than the distance from the bottom of the stopper 7 to the top of the stop ring 4.
[0026] If the displacement of the measuring head 31 exceeds its preset stroke, the measuring head 31 of the magnetic grating ruler 3 will be crushed due to excessive pressure. In the design of the present application, when the displacement of the measuring head 31 continues to increase until the limiting cylinder 7 contacts the limiting ring 4, the limiting cylinder 7 will play a role to prevent the bottom of the first probe 5 from continuing to compress the measuring head 31 of the magnetic grating ruler 3, thereby effectively avoiding the damage of the measuring head 31 due to excessive pressure, and providing reliable protection for the magnetic grating ruler 3.
[0027] The two ends of the elastic element 6 respectively abut against the bottom of the first probe 5 and the top of the limiting ring 4, for providing a pre-tightening force to make the top of the first probe 5 always press against the second probe of the robot. When the second probe does not reach the zero position of the axis to be calibrated, the bottom of the first probe 5 always abuts against the measuring head 31 of the magnetic grating ruler 3. The second probe of the present application always maintains a close contact state with the measuring groove on the robot. The position of the measuring groove on the robot is fixed and unchangeable.
[0028] It should be noted that when installing the zero point calibration device, it needs to be fixed on the robot shaft to be calibrated. The sleeve 1 is installed on the zero point stud through a threaded connection mechanism, and the top of the sleeve 1 extends into the positioning hole to ensure the accuracy of the installation position. During the operation of the device, when the shaft to be calibrated starts to rotate, the sleeve 1, the tail plug 2 and the second probe rotate synchronously. At the same time, the profile of the measuring groove on the robot changes with the rotation of the shaft to be calibrated. This profile change drives the second probe of the robot to produce axial displacement. The axial displacement is pre-tightened by the elastic element 6, and then transmitted to the first probe 5, and then transmitted to the measuring head 31 of the magnetic grating ruler 3 by the first probe 5, and finally drives the measuring head 31 of the magnetic grating ruler 3 to move. The magnetic grating ruler 3 can generate signals corresponding to the displacement in real time, and transmit these signals to the control system. After receiving the signals, the control system draws an "M" type displacement curve, and then automatically identifies the lowest point in the curve, and records the corresponding joint angle value at this time, which is the zero point position of the shaft to be calibrated. In this process, the needle bearing 8 can keep the magnetic grating ruler 3 stationary independent of the rotating tail plug 2, effectively avoiding the problem of cable entanglement caused by the rotation of the tail plug 2. When not reaching the zero point position, the bottom of the first probe 5 will continuously contact the measuring head 31 of the magnetic grating ruler 3, so as to stably transmit the displacement information. When reaching the zero point position, the measuring groove will be sunken, which will trigger the displacement mutation, and then the accurate zero point calibration is completed. The zero point calibration device of the present application isolates the rotational motion of the magnetic grating ruler 3 and the tail plug 2 through the needle bearing 8, fundamentally solving the problem of breakage of the tail cable of the magnetic grating ruler 3 due to twisting, and improving the service life of the device; the preset stroke of the measuring head 31 in the limiting cylinder 7 is not less than the distance from the bottom of the limiting cylinder 7 to the top of the limiting ring 4, and the limiting cylinder 7 can timely block the pressure transmission when the displacement of the measuring head 31 exceeds the preset stroke, effectively avoiding damage to the measuring head 31 of the magnetic grating ruler 3 due to excessive pressure, thereby ensuring the reliability of high-precision measurement.
[0029] In the embodiment of the present application, the preset stroke of the measuring head 31 is 10mm.
[0030] In the embodiment of the present application, the bottom of the tail plug 2 is a character-shaped structure 22, which is used to match with a character-shaped nut on the zero point stud of the shaft to be calibrated.
[0031] In the embodiment of the present application, the number of needle bearings 8 is two, which are respectively arranged at the top and bottom of the axial cavity 21 of the tail plug 2, so that the top and bottom of the tail plug 2 can obtain stable and accurate support during rotation, effectively dispersing the stress generated during rotation.
[0032] In this embodiment of the present application, the zero point calibration device further includes a retaining spring 9. An annular retaining groove is provided at the bottom of the axial cavity 21. The retaining spring 9 is disposed within the annular retaining groove and is located at the bottom of the magnetic scale 3. The retaining spring 9 is used to limit the axial displacement of the needle roller bearing 8 located at the bottom of the tail plug 2. The bottom of the limiting ring 4 abuts against the needle roller bearing 8 located at the top of the tail plug 2.
[0033] In the embodiment of the present application, the zero point calibration device further includes a fastener. The side wall of the limit ring 4 is provided with a radial threaded hole 41. One end of the fastener is screwed into the radial threaded hole 41 and presses against the outer wall of the magnetic scale 3 to achieve locking of the limit ring 4 and the magnetic scale 3.
[0034] It should be noted that the present application isolates the top cross-section of the tail plug 2 by means of a needle roller bearing 8 located at the top of the tail plug 2, so that when the sleeve 1 and the tail plug 2 rotate, the magnetic scale 3 and the retaining ring 4 remain stationary. Specifically, the retaining ring 4 is sleeved onto the outer circumference of the magnetic scale 3, and the two are assembled and positioned using a clearance fit, and are ultimately fixedly connected by fasteners.
